Lahore: The Pakistan Carpet Manufacturers and Exporters Association (PCMEA) expressed satisfaction over the successful conclusion of a three-day international exhibition in Lahore, noting that the event surpassed expectations in terms of export orders and participation from international buyers. PCMEA Chairman Mian Atiq-ur-Rehman and Vice Chairman Riaz Ahmed acknowledged the extensive support from the Trade Development Authority of Pakistan (TDAP) in organizing the event.
At a review meeting assessing the exhibition's outcomes, attended by key industry figures including Patron-in-Chief Abdul Latif Malik and Carpet Training Institute Chairperson Ejaz-ur-Rehman, the participants commended the organizing team for their effective management of the event. The exhibition has instilled a sense of optimism in Pakistan's handmade carpet industry, according to Atiq-ur-Rehman and Ahmed.
The leaders revealed that significant export orders were placed during the event, with official figures pending completion of data compilation. They also announced plans for Pakistan's active participation in upcoming international exhibitions, Carpet Expo in Türkiye, Heimtextil and Domotex in Germany, scheduled for January next year.
Efforts were discussed to strengthen trade relations with foreign companies that attended the exhibition, including sending goodwill letters to maintain long-term business connections. The PCMEA leadership urged the TDAP to continue its support for these efforts to enhance exports and earn valuable foreign exchange for the country.
